A steel ball whose mass is 100 g is rolling at a rate of 2.8 m/sec. What is it’s momentum?

Answer:

The momentum of the steel ball is 0.28 kg m/sec.

Step-by-step explanation:

The momentum of an object can be calculated using the formula: momentum = mass x velocity. In this case, the mass of the steel ball is 100 g, which is equivalent to 0.1 kg. The velocity of the ball is 2.8 m/sec. Plugging in the values into the formula, we get:

momentum = 0.1 kg x 2.8 m/sec

momentum = 0.28 kg m/sec

So the momentum of the steel ball is 0.28 kg m/sec.
